This bill amends the law governing relocation assistance in eminent domain cases.
Current law provides that if a person entitled to relocation assistance does not accept the acquiring authority’s offer, the acquiring authority must initiate a contested case proceeding. This bill would require a contested case proceeding in cases where a person does not accept the acquiring authority’s denial of relocation assistance, in addition to the determination of the amount of assistance.
The bill would be effective the day following final enactment and apply to relocation assistance claims and claims of eligibility for relocation assistance pending on or made after that date.
